Born Judith Marjorie Collins on 01 May 1939 in Washington, US.
UK Singles
3
1970
Both Sides Now
-
Judy Collins
entered the UK charts on 18 January 1970 and reached number 14.
Amazing Grace
-
Judy Collins
entered the UK charts on 31 December 1970 and reached number 5.
1975
Send In The Clowns
-
Judy Collins
entered the UK charts on 18 May 1975 and reached number 6.
